Prioritize Whole Foods
The cornerstone of sustainable weight loss is focusing on whole, unprocessed foods. Fill your plate with f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ains. These foods are packed with nutrients, keeping you feeling full and satisfied, reducing cravings for less healthy options.
Try incorporating a variety of colorful vegetables into your meals for maximum nutritional benefits. Learning to cook healthy meals at home is a significant step towards long-term success.
Mindful Eating Practices
Mindful eating goes beyond simply consuming food; it’s about paying attention to your body’s hunger and fullness cues. Avoid distractions like TV or your phone while eating. Savor each bite, chew slowly, and truly appreciate your food. This practice can help you recognize when you’re truly hungry and prevent overeating.

Incorporate Regular Exercise
Physical activity is crucial for weight loss and overall health.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ic exercise per week, such as brisk walking, cycling, or swimming. You can also incorporate strength training exercises two to three times a week to build muscle mass and boost your metabolism. Finding an exercise buddy can make it more fun and keep you accountable.
Prioritize Sleep and Stress Management
Believe it or not, getting enough sleep and managing stress are essential for weight loss success. When you’re sleep-deprived or stressed, your body produces more cortisol, a hormone that can lead to increased appetite and weight gain.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ep each night and find healthy ways to manage stress, such as meditation, yoga, or spending time in nature. Hydration is Key
Drinking plenty of water throughout the day is often overlooked but incredibly important for weight loss. Water helps you feel full, aids digestion, and can even boost your metabolism slightly.
